Output 317945deffaa203c04f63321adb941e2e7bdeb0ec43c7778575c70201aab38fa:194

value
300876
script pubkey
OP_0 OP_PUSHBYTES_20 37c556fa49c3aaada5c114f1237f1cfb17deb849
address
tb1qxlz4d7jfcw42mfwpzncjxlculvtaawzfygknle
transaction
317945deffaa203c04f63321adb941e2e7bdeb0ec43c7778575c70201aab38fa
confirmations
265
spent
false